Jack Yao
Birthday: 1984-10-29 | Place of Birth: Taiwan...
Known For
Acting
Year
Title
Role
2021
Life in a Box
as Kurt
2020
Dear Tenant
as Li-Wei
2020
Detention
as Shen Hua
2019
The Mirror
as Hou Fang-ping
2010
Au Revoir Taipei
as Kai